Casten Statement on Trump’s Plan to Deploy Troops to Chicago

September 04, 2025 Casten Statement on Trump’s Plan to Deploy Troops to Chicago Washington, D.C. — U.S. Congressman Sean Casten (IL-06) released the following statement on President Trump’s plan to deploy National Guard troops to Chicago: “Addressing crime and keeping the American people safe is one of the most important responsibilities of the federal government. But the president’s plan to deploy National Guard troops into Chicago isn’t about that. It’s about intimidating the people of Illinois, getting Americans used to the sight of soldiers with guns patrolling our streets, and violating federal law and the Constitution. “Unless and until a request is made by Governor Pritzker, the president’s plan is a brazen and authoritarian attempt to violate Illinois’ state sovereignty. If the Trump Administration truly cared about addressing crime, it would end its illegal impoundment of hundreds of millions of dollars in federal funding for programs that we know make our communities safer. Deploying troops into Illinois is nothing more than security theater and does little to help the people who live here. “I remain in close contact with Governor Pritzker and other state and local leaders, and will continue to do everything possible to keep Illinoisans safe.” ### Print Email Share Tweet
